Does not easily fit older 'standard' white wire shelving, but will with some force
I say 'easily' because it will fit if you smash it in with force. I bought these because one of my wire shelf clips snapped off at the hook part after putting too much weight on one side. The wire shelving is over 20 years old, so I figure if one went, others would surely follow, and I wanted to have these on hand. I couldn't find any other type of screw that was similar, and I didn't want a nail in unit, because I just wanted to use the same hole the old one came out of.These are just a tiny bit longer than the old ones. Putting the screw into the same hole the broken one came out of, the shelf is just a hair lower than before. It's probably a mm or 2, so not a deal breaker, but still, why can't they make the same sizes?The problem came in when trying to put the wire shelf into the hook... nope, wasn't going. It's hard to measure, but by eyeball, it looks like it should fit... but the hook shape isn't a U, it wraps a bit more around. Pushing down HARD on the shelf itself (meaning have the L brackets in already), managed to get it into the hook. This was NOT easy, and it didn't seem like it would fit at all. It's possible that I stretched the hook getting it in also, but it held, and it didn't break.The good part is, the difficulty seating it in the hole keeps the shelf from easily lifting back up. Hopefully, this will last 20 more years.

It’s usable …
The problem is these are shorter and much tighter than the originals from 30 years ago. So while you can get them to work, it takes pliers to get them on and if your original install used an over/under approach, these are too short to replace the original clips in the original holes. So that’s a bit of a drag….
